Parallel translations
WEB
World English Bible · 2000For who can eat, or who can have enjoyment, more than I?
KJV
King James Version · 1611For who can eat, or who else can hasten hereunto, more than I?
ASV
American Standard Version · 1901For who can eat, or who can have enjoyment, more than I?
BBE
Bible in Basic English · 1949Who may take food or have pleasure without him?
YLT
Young's Literal Translation · 1862For who eateth and who hasteth out more than I?
DRA
Douay-Rheims (Challoner) · 1752Who shall so feast and abound with delights as I?
DBY
Darby Bible · 1890For who can eat, or who be eager, more than I?
Context
v.24There is nothing better for a manthanthat he should eat and drink, and make his soul enjoy good in his labor. This also I saw, that it is from the hand of God.
v.25This passage
v.26For to the man that pleaseth him God giveth wisdom, and knowledge, and joy; but to the sinner he giveth travail, to gather and to heap up, that he may give to him that pleaseth God. This also is vanity and a striving after wind.
